Transaction 1329e7f79da406a52162db5df356661244bbcf485a9a4eb7654fc8af0c35aecb
1 Input
1 Output
-
1329e7f79da406a52162db5df356661244bbcf485a9a4eb7654fc8af0c35aecb:0
- value
- 508258
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ff28af26c93570d6761432b798b182fa76b0bed7
- address
- bc1qlu527fkfx4cdvas5x2me3vvzlfmtp0khp5mr3u